Q: Is 10,290,633 a Prime Number?
A: No, 10,290,633 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 10290633 can be evenly divided by 1 3 97 291 35,363 106,089 3,430,211 and 10,290,633, with no remainder.
Since 10,290,633 cannot be divided by just 1 and 10,290,633, it is not a prime number.
